VC++ 60基于窗口的模糊查询的例子.doc
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_05.gif)
《VC++ 60基于窗口的模糊查询的例子.doc》由会员分享,可在线阅读,更多相关《VC++ 60基于窗口的模糊查询的例子.doc(16页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、 基于窗口的MFC工程模糊查询例子一、 首先建立一个基于窗口的MFC AppWizard(exe)的工程。步骤如下: 在菜单栏中点击file-new弹出窗口,选择Projects选项卡-选择MFC AppWizard(exe),之后再Project name输入自己的工程名称,在Location中选择工程的存放位置 .点击OK按钮,出现如下窗口 选择Dialog based,如下1.4. 之后点击Finish,。1.5点击OK,即可完成基于窗口的MFC工程的创建二、创建数据库、连接数据库的方法我使用的是ADO连接,具体步骤如下: 注:数据库自行建立,只要有一个表即可,本例中数据库名为LLJYd
2、atabase,sa密码为空 2.1 首先在文件视图(FileView)中,选择Header Files ,在右侧的代码中添加#import C:program filescommon filessystemadomsado15.dll rename_namespace(ADOBS) rename(EOF,adoEOF)using namespace ADOBS; 添加如下图所示 在类视图(ClassView)中,展开CTestApp-双击CTestApp构造方法,在右侧声明全局的数据库访问变量,BOOL Flag = FALSE; /登录标识_ConnectionPtr m_pCon; /A
3、DO连接对象_RecordsetPtr m_pRs; _RecordsetPtr m_pRs1;_CommandPtr m_pCom;CString user,password;/记录当前用户CString strserver; CString strdbName;CString strUser;CString strPassword在CTestApp类添加IniAdo()方法类视图(ClassView)CTestApp类中添加IniAdo()方法,如下 点击出现对话框,点击确定,在InitAdo()方法中添加下列代码:tryCString temp;char filepathMAX_PATH
4、;GetModuleFileName(NULL,filepath,MAX_PATH);temp = theApp.ExtractFilePath(filepath);/获取可执行文件的路径/m_pCon.CreateInstance(ADODB.Connection);CString strAdoConn;char temp1100;GetPrivateProfileString(DatabaseConfig,Server,temp1,100,temp+login.ini);strserver = (TCHAR *)temp1;GetPrivateProfileString(DatabaseC
5、onfig,Database,temp1,100,temp+login.ini);strdbName = temp1;GetPrivateProfileString(DatabaseConfig,User,temp1,100,temp+login.ini);strUser = temp1;GetPrivateProfileString(DatabaseConfig,PWD,temp1,100,temp+login.ini);strPassword = temp1;strAdoConn.Format(driver=SQL Server;SERVER=%s;UID=%s;PWD=%s;DATABA
6、SE=%s, strserver, strUser, strPassword, strdbName);m_pCon.CreateInstance(_uuidof(Connection);m_pCon-ConnectionString = (_bstr_t)strAdoConn;m_pCon-Open(,NULL);m_pCom.CreateInstance(ADODB.Command);m_pRs.CreateInstance(_uuidof(Recordset);m_pRs1.CreateInstance(_uuidof(Recordset);/ADOFLAG = TRUE;catch(_c
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- VC+ 60基于窗口的模糊查询的例子 VC 60 基于 窗口 模糊 查询 例子
![提示](https://www.taowenge.com/images/bang_tan.gif)
限制150内